Memorable Manitobans: Thomas Percy “Tom” Chester (1904-2002)Golf pro. Born at Charleswood on 29 March 1904, son of Thomas Chester and Rosa Sherrice, he was head professional of the Charleswood Golf Club from 1932 to 1974, and a Life Member of the Canadian Professional Golfers Association. On 24 October 1936, he married Margot Brown. They retired to Neepawa where he died on 23 April 2002. He is commemorated by a public park in Winnipeg. See also:
